The TPS61193-Q1 is an automotive high-efficiency, low-EMI LED driver with an integrated DC-DC converter supporting both boost and SEPIC mode operation. It features three high-precision current sinks with 1% typical matching, supporting up to 100 mA per channel. The device includes adaptive output voltage control to minimize power consumption and supports a wide input voltage range from 4.5 V to 40 V, suitable for automotive stop/start and load dump conditions.

Texas Instruments TPS61193-Q1 technical specifications.
| Number of Channels | 3 |
| Input Voltage (Min) | 4.5V |
| Input Voltage (Max) | 40V |
| Output Voltage (Max) | 45V |
| Output Current Per Channel | 100mA |
| Switching Frequency | 0.3 to 2.2MHz |
| Dimming Ratio | 10,000:1 at 100 Hz |
| Operating Temperature Range | -40 to 125°C |
| Automotive Qualification | AEC-Q100 Qualified |
| Temperature Grade | Grade 1 |
| RoHS | Compliant |
